Sofia Richie Shares Special Way She’s Cherishing Mom Life With Baby Eloise

Sofia Richie Grainge wants to remember every moment of motherhood.
The 25-year-old—who welcomed her daughter Eloise Samantha Grainge on May 20 with her music executive husband Elliot Grainge—shared the sweet way she’s treasuring every memory with her baby girl.
“It’s really good for me mentally to journal. And I actually found out I’m a scrapbook girl,” she told The Wall Street Journal in an interview published Aug. 15. “I wrote everything down in a scrapbook for Eloise, just things I didn’t want to forget.”
Needless to say, Sofia—who is the daughter of Lionel Richie and his ex-wife Diane Alexander—is already adjusting well to life with a 2-month-old.
“I wake up around 6 a.m. and go see my daughter,” she explained. “I have a little morning routine with her: We wake up, she eats, we have a bit of playtime before her first nap at 8.”
Mom life for Sofia, though, hasn’t always been so methodical.
“The first four weeks, I was with her 24 hours a day,” she continued. “Now she’s gotten to an age where I have her on a sleep schedule, so she’s taking a lot of 90-minute naps throughout the day. My life and everything that I need to get done have to happen within those 90 minutes.”
And having to adapt to 90-minute moments of productivity has been a challenge, especially considering she describes herself as “Type A.”
“I’m a very scheduled, organized person. I’m very type A, clean and organized,” Sofia shared. “But I’ve also learned that I don’t have to be that way, because when you have a baby, all of that kind of goes out the window. I’ve learned that I’m more flexible than I think.”
The fashion icon has also learned that being mom to baby Eloise is her “first priority,” both now and going forward.
“Now as a mom, I think I’ll create some more boundaries,” Sofia said. “If I’ve gotta go to fashion week, then she’s going to pack her bags and come with me. If she can’t, then I’m not going to be able to make it.”
In addition to adding Eloise to their family, read on to see the major milestones of Sofia and Elliot’s relationship.
Sofia Richie sparked dating rumors with music executive Elliot Grainge in the spring of 2021, nearly a year after her breakup from Scott Disick.
Though the pair's history went way back—as Elliot's dad, Universal Music Group CEO Lucian Grainge, is a longtime friend of Sofia's father Lionel Richie—romance speculation started swirling when they were seen out on a date.
The model confirmed her relationship with Elliot in April 2021, posting this PDA photo on Instagram.
Shortly Sofia went public with the romance, a source told E! News that Lionel gave his seal of approval.
"He thinks they are a perfect match and it was very natural progression for Sofia and Elliot to get together," the insider said in April 2021. "They are all family friends and Sofia and Elliot [started] hanging out more recently this year."
Elliot popped the question in early 2022 during a Hawaiian vacation with friends and family.
"Sofia truly had no idea," another source told E! News at the time. "She thought they were just going on a fun vacation. Sofia's reaction was epic, she was so surprised and taken back."
In May 2022, the couple celebrated their engagement with their inner circle—including Sofia's sister Nicole Richie and brother-in-law Joel Madden—at a backyard bash.
Sofia and Elliot tied the knot on April 22, 2023 at Hotel du Cap-Eden-Roc in the South of France.
The newlyweds jetted off for their tropical honeymoon shortly after the lavish nuptials.
Sofia announced her pregnancy in January 2024, telling Vogue, "I've learned more in the past six months than I have in my entire life. And also just like what the female body is capable of."
The influencer continued, "Every week brings new things, whether it's hormonal shifts or expansion—there's just so much our bodies go through, and it's so interesting to experience it all."
Days after sharing news of her pregnancy, Sofia posted a TikTok video of her and Elliot's reaction to learning that they were having a daughter.
"Oh my god," Sofia screamed after she was showered with pink confetti during an intimate backyard reveal with Elliot. "I'm so excited!"
